Given the sparse MOT history, an in-person inspection should prioritise components typically overlooked at low mileage but critical for longevity. Focus on the suspension system—particularly coil springs, bushes, and shock absorbers—for signs of premature dry-rotting or corrosion, as static periods can compromise elastomeric parts. The brake system, while not flagged in the MOT, warrants attention; check for moisture in the brake fluid reservoir and inspect discs for uneven wear, which could indicate binding calipers or inadequate ventilation. Structural integrity should also be assessed, especially around wheel arches and underbody, for corrosion or rust pitting that may have developed during extended storage.
